(Vienna) In caps because I can't contain my excitement as I ate! Recommended by a friend and this is by far one of the most worth it schnitzel I've seen around. It's about 10 euros and the serving is huge. Most memorable is how thin the pork cutlet is.
Beef goulash was on the saltier side but as tender as I expected.
Located in Stephanplatz, this place is highly central
Had this delicious meat bun in Salzburg in the 33 alley next to the main shopping street. For £3.70, it is a real deal. Love the curry, onions/coriander mix, chili in it. Bursting with flavours. Extremely filling.

[Salzburg] Followed a local blog and checked out this biergarten, it made our night! We were craving for crisp roast pork and coming here was a dream come true. The right amount of fats and generous amounts for £6.20 euros. 1 litre of beer is also for ~£6. Ribs were delicious too.
The biergarten fits 1000 people. On Sunday night, it was almost filled. What a jolly time.
